VI.21 Online and Continuing Education (OCE): Policies and Best Practices

VI.21.1 OCE Policies and Procedures

Faculty development

  • OCE currently provides education and support to faculty interested in teaching online., e.g., preparation of instructors to use technology, implementation of adult learning theory, intentionally designed courses, online student support services.

Curriculum Oversight

Continue the current practice outlined in the faculty handbook: the oversight of curriculum taught in OCE campus is done by departments/programs and the relevant Curriculum Committee.

De facto tenure

  • To help ensure that de facto tenure does not occur, the relevant dean will review all contracts of those teaching on any campus (McMinnville, Portland, and OCE).
  • Relevant items from the handbook (IV.5):
    • “Normally, adjunct faculty are limited to no more than 18 load units in any given academic year, where 33 units is defined as full time (23 of teaching per se and 10 of other, such as advising and service functions). Included in the 18 is teaching within any division [campus (McMinnville, Portland, and OCE)] of the college. In no case will a load of more than 20 units be approved.”
    • “Adjunct faculty are not eligible for tenure, promotion in rank, or sabbatical leave.”
